Verdict

A long-established race at this meeting for 3-y-o newcomers and the market looks sure to provide plenty of clues. Preference is for PORTCULLIS who makes most appeal on pedigree for a yard with a good record in this. Godolphin's Crown Knott can't be ignored, while North Beach is another to note representing last year's winning trainer.

Horse Racing Basic Terms

Exacta

A bet selecting the first and second horses in a race in the correct order. An exacta box refers to paying a little more to ensure they can finish in either order.

Apprentice

A new jockey who has not ridden a certain number of winners in a specified time period.

Underlay

A horse that is going off at lower odds than it deserves based on performance.
